ICD-10 Code L97.525 – Non-pressure chronic ulcer of other part of left foot with muscle involvement without evidence of necrosis (2026): Diagnosis, Symptoms & Billing Guide

The ICD-10 code for Non-pressure chronic ulcer of other part of left foot with muscle involvement without evidence of necrosis is L97.525.
2026 ICD-10-CM Diagnosis Code L97.525 – Non-pressure chronic ulcer of other part of left foot with muscle involvement without evidence of necrosis

What it is

This code identifies a chronic, non-pressure ulcer on another part of the left foot that extends to muscle, with no necrosis documented. It is used when the wound is not caused by pressure and the left foot location is specified.

Clinical signs

Typical findings include an open, non-healing wound of the left foot with documented muscle involvement. Clinical features vary; refer to documentation for depth, location, and whether necrosis is absent.

When to use this code

Use this code when the record clearly states a chronic ulcer on the left foot, involves muscle, and does not show necrosis. You should also confirm that the site is “other part of left foot,” not heel, midfoot, or toe. If the note is vague, check documentation.

Do not use for

Do not use this code if the ulcer is pressure-related, if necrosis is present, or if the documentation does not confirm muscle involvement. It is also wrong for ulcers on a different left-foot site.

Coding tip

Verify laterality, exact foot location, depth, and absence of necrosis before assigning L97.525.
